Commercial waterproofing refers to the specialized techniques and materials used to protect large-scale buildings and structures from water intrusion. Unlike residential waterproofing, commercial systems are designed to handle more complex building designs, larger surface areas, and stricter code requirements. These systems safeguard critical components like foundations, basements, roofs, and exterior walls from leaks, moisture damage, and mold. Whether it’s for a warehouse, retail center, or office complex, commercial waterproofing systems are essential to maintaining the longevity, safety, and efficiency of any commercial property. Why is Commercial Waterproofing So Important?
Water intrusion is more than a nuisance it’s a threat to your building’s structural integrity and safety. Leaks, damp basements, or condensation can lead to:
Mold growth that affects air quality and health
Cracks and deterioration in concrete or masonry
Flooding that damages equipment or inventory
Increased maintenance and repair costs
Decreased property value
By installing commercial waterproofing systems, you're not just solving current moisture issues you’re preventing future damage.
What Are Commercial Waterproofing Systems?
Commercial waterproofing systems are specially designed to prevent water from entering a building through the foundation, walls, or roofing. These systems are more robust than residential waterproofing solutions due to the size and complexity of commercial structures.
Depending on the building type and location, a complete commercial waterproofing system might include:
Below-grade waterproofing (foundations, basements, parking structures)
Above-grade waterproofing (rooftops, terraces, balconies)
Sealants and caulking to prevent water penetration around windows and expansion joints
Moisture barriers and drainage mats to direct water away from the structure
Exterior membranes and coatings that offer long-term protection

Signs Your Building Needs Commercial Waterproofing
You don’t always need to wait for a leak to consider waterproofing. Here are some early warning signs that your building may be vulnerable:
Musty smells in basements or lower levels
Damp spots or water stains on walls and ceilings
Efflorescence (white mineral deposits) on concrete surfaces
Cracks in walls or floors
Pooling water around the foundation
Increased humidity or condensation indoors

Commercial Waterproofing and New Construction
Waterproofing isn’t just for existing buildings it’s also essential for new construction. Integrating a commercial waterproofing system during the construction phase ensures that your foundation, walls, and roof remain protected from day one. We work alongside builders and developers to install moisture barriers, foundation membranes, and other preventive solutions during key stages of the build.
This is especially important for commercial buildings in areas with high water tables or frequent rainfall.
